在现代社会,远程创建服务器已经成为很多人和企业的一项基本技能。无论是为了开发、测试,还是为了部署应用程序,能够在云端或本地快速搭建服务器是极其重要的。今天,我们就来聊聊怎么远程创建服务器。
想象一下,你在家里,想要搭建一个网站,或者是开发一个应用,但你的个人电脑可能无法满足需求。这个时候,远程创建服务器就显得尤为重要。其实,远程创建服务器并没有想象中的那么复杂,掌握一些基本步骤和工具,就能轻松搞定。
首先,你需要选择一个合适的云服务提供商。市面上有很多选择,比如 AWS、Azure、Google Cloud、DigitalOcean 等等。这些平台各有特点,像 AWS 提供的服务非常丰富,适合大型企业;而 DigitalOcean 则更加简洁,适合初学者和中小型项目。选择合适的服务提供商,首先要考虑你的需求,比如预算、项目规模、技术栈等等。
一旦选定了云服务提供商,接下来就是创建服务器实例。以 AWS 为例,登录到 AWS 控制台后,你会看到一个“EC2”选项。EC2 是 AWS 的一种基础计算服务。点击进入后,选择“启动实例”,这里你会被要求选择一个 AMI(亚马逊机器镜像),这个镜像可以理解为你的操作系统,比如 Ubuntu、CentOS 或 Windows 等等。选择你熟悉的操作系统,可以让后续的操作更加顺手。
接下来,你需要选择实例类型。这里的实例类型决定了你的服务器性能,简单来说,就是 CPU、内存、存储等配置。对于初学者,通常选择 T2.micro 或 T3.micro 这样的入门级实例就足够了,它们在 AWS 免费套餐内,适合小型项目和学习使用。
在配置实例时,你也可能需要设置网络和安全组。网络就是你服务器的访问方式,安全组则是用来控制哪些 IP 地址可以访问你的服务器。为了安全起见,建议只开放必要的端口,比如 22(SSH 远程登录)和 80(HTTP 访问)。当然,如果你还打算使用 HTTPS,那就别忘了开放 443 端口。
当所有配置都完成后,点击“启动”,系统会提示你创建一个密钥对,用于 SSH 登录。一定要将密钥文件保存在安全的地方,因为如果丢失了,你将无法再远程访问你的服务器。
好了,服务器实例创建完成后,你就可以使用 SSH 进行远程登录了。打开你的终端(Linux 或 Mac 用户)或使用 PuTTY(Windows 用户),输入以下命令:
ssh -i /path/to/your/key.pem ec2-user@your.server.ip.address
这里的 /path/to/your/key.pem
是你之前保存的密钥文件路径,ec2-user
是默认的用户名(根据不同的操作系统可能会有所不同),而 your.server.ip.address
则是你服务器的 IP 地址。
成功登录后,你将看到一个命令行界面,这里就是你的服务器环境。接下来,你可以根据项目需求安装必要的软件,比如 Web 服务器(Nginx 或 Apache)、数据库(MySQL、PostgreSQL)等。
值得注意的是,远程管理服务器时一定要注意安全性。定期更新系统和应用程序,使用强密码和密钥认证,限制 SSH 登录的 IP 地址,这些都是保障你服务器安全的好习惯。
除了手动操作,很多云服务提供商也提供了 API 接口,你可以通过编程的方式来创建和管理服务器。这对于需要频繁部署和管理多个服务器的团队来说,会节省很多时间。
说到这里,可能有些人会问,难道远程创建服务器就没有什么难点吗?其实,确实有一些挑战,比如网络延迟、配置错误、权限设置等问题。在遇到这些问题时,不妨去查阅相关文档或社区论坛,通常会找到解决方案。
最后,远程创建服务器的过程虽然听起来有点复杂,但只要多加练习,掌握基本的操作,实际上你会发现这是一项非常有趣的技能。无论是为了学习新技术,还是为了完成项目,这项技能都能为你带来很大的便利。
希望这篇文章能帮助你更好地理解远程创建服务器的流程。无论你是开发者、学生,还是对技术感兴趣的普通用户,掌握这项技能都将为你打开新的大门。加油,祝你在远程服务器的世界里探索愉快!
文章摘自:https://idc.huochengrm.cn/zj/2438.html
评论